Buying Guide: Key Considerations For Stainless Steel Screw Anchors
To choose the best stainless steel screw anchors, consider these factors:
- Environment: Stainless steel 304 offers strong corrosion resistance suitable for bathrooms, kitchens, and outdoor spaces. In marine or highly salty environments, look for marine-grade 316 stainless.
- Substrate compatibility: Drywall, plaster, concrete, brick, and wood each require specific anchor types. Ensure your chosen anchors match the material you intend to fasten into.
- Load requirements: Heavy-duty fixtures demand larger anchors and longer screws. Verify load ratings or experienced user guidance to avoid premature failure.
- Size range and versatility: Kits with multiple sizes simplify different mounting tasks and help you stock for future projects.
- Installation ease: Self-drilling anchors reduce predrilling time, while some substrates still benefit from predrilled holes for precision and safety.
- Durability and finish: Look for corrosion-resistant screws (304 stainless) and reinforced nylon or metal anchors designed to withstand years of use.
- Storage and organization: A well-organized kit with labeled compartments saves time and prevents mix-ups during projects.
How To Choose By Use Case
- General shelving and pictures: Lightweight to medium anchors; consider multi-size kits for flexibility.
- Bathrooms and kitchens: Prioritize corrosion resistance and reliable hold in plaster or tile substrates.
- Outdoor or marine settings: Opt for high-grade stainless or stainless with corrosion inhibitors and robust threading.
- Concrete and masonry: Use wedge or heavier-duty anchors designed for solid substrates; ensure the screw length matches the embedment depth.
